Floor tiles are commonly made of ceramic or stone, although recent technological advances have resulted in rubber or glass tiles for floors as well. Ceramic tiles may be painted and glazed. Small mosaic tiles may be laid in various patterns. Floor tiles are typically set into mortar consisting of sand, Portland cement and often a latex additive.
Tile was also manufactured in a series of graduated wedge shapes for installation between steel members as a fireproof flat arch floor structure, to be covered with a concrete wearing surface above. In other cases, structural clay tile was used as a permanent form material to reduce the bulk and weight of structural concrete floor slabs. [8]
Floor covering is a term to generically describe any finish material applied over a floor structure to provide a walking surface. Both terms are used interchangeably but floor covering refers more to loose-laid materials. Materials almost always classified as flooring include carpet, laminate, tile, and vinyl.
Quarry tile is a building material, usually 1 ⁄ 2 to 3 ⁄ 4 inch (13 to 19 mm) thick, made by either the extrusion process or more commonly by press forming and firing natural clay or shales. [ 1 ] [ 2 ] Quarry tile is manufactured from clay in a manner similar to bricks . [ 3 ]
Vinyl floor tiling. Vinyl composition tile (VCT) is a finished flooring material used primarily in commercial and institutional applications.
